Clever Design Ideas for Very Small Downstairs Toilets
Space can be a premium when it comes to downstairs restrooms. But that doesn't mean you have to skimp on style or usability. With a little innovation, even the tiniest of spaces can be transformed into a sophisticated and practical retreat.
Consider these clever design hacks to maximize every inch of your small downstairs toilet:
- Leverage wall space with floating vanities and sleek cabinets.
- Reflect the space by placing a large mirror on the opposite side.
- Select a mini toilet that optimizes space without neglecting comfort.
- Utilize bright and reflective colors to create an feeling of openness.
